AA KSML availability:

-Most domestic routes where meals are served (in J or F)
-Flights to Europe or Asia in all classes.
-Flights to Belo Horizonte, Brasilia, Porto Alegre, Recife, Rio de Janeiro, Salvador, Sao Paulo, Brazil in all classes.
-Flights to Asuncion, Paraguay in all classes.
-Flights to Buenos Aires, Argentina in all classes.
-Flights to Santiago, Chile in all classes.
-Flights to Montevideo, Uruguay in all classes.

UA KSML availability:

-EWR-SFO in J
-EWR-LAX in J
-BOS-SFO in J
-Flights between the US mainland or Guam and Hawaii in J or F.
-Flights to Europe or Asia in all classes.
-Flights to Argentina, Brazil, Chile and Peru in all classes.

Stogel-Hermolis Scale:
1. Inedible, wouldn't feed to a dog. (Stogel [long-life])
2. Disgusting, would only eat if starving
3. Barely edible, would only eat if very hungry
4. Below average, but would eat if hungry (Stogel [fresh-frozen])
5. Average/typical KSML, would eat if hungry (Borenstein?)
6. Above average KSML (Borenstein?)
7. A good KSML, might even eat if not hungry.
8. A very good KSML
9. An excellent KSML, could pass for something served in a decent restaurant.
10. Top of the line KSML, would be happy eating this at a decent restaurant. (Hermolis)

USA-Australia routes (economy): Koshair, O-U, Hamotzi, CS.
USA-Sydney  (First): Regal - meat and chicken meals.
Australia-USA routes (economy): Lewis Continental, K-A, Hamotzi, CY.
LH EWR-FRA Y Regal Chicken
LH MUC-EWR Y Sohar Hot meat meal and cold sandwich
LH FRA-VIE C Sohar Cold Meal (fish)
OS VIE TLV C VIE Local Co (hechser Rabbi Schwartz) Hot
US TLV PHL C Hamasbia
UA(CO) EWR-TLV Y Regal Beef meal (2010)
SA JNB-CPT-JNB Y Hot Meal from Joburg Beth Din
MN(BA) JNB-VFA Meal from Joburg Beth Din
SQ JFK-FRA Suites very poor Borenstein meal, labeled business class, chicken, no real dishes, very little food.
EK SYD-AKL  F    Lewis, no hot meal.
NZ AKL-LAX  Y    Gray's deli, fish meal.
TK CPT-IST  J/Y    Norries Caterers - CPT Beth Din - Milk Snack (Sandwich & Muffin CPT-JNB leg) Meat Dinner, Milk breakfast
